Tunnel Container For Sale
Tunnel containers have double doors at both ends, unlike standard shipping containers. This makes it easy to gain access to heavy equipment, such as diggers and vehicles.

Stores
A 40 ft tunnel containers container is a kind of container for shipping that has double doors at both ends, instead of only one side like conventional containers. This is an extremely useful feature for a variety of different reasons. It can make it easier to store large or bulky items. The dual access points also enable faster loading and unloading, which is ideal for warehouses with a lot of traffic and other fast-paced environments.
Tunnel containers are typically constructed with higher roofs than conventional containers. This makes them an ideal option for tall items. The extra foot can make a huge difference in storage capacity and also permits better ventilation when compared to a regular container tunnel.
Because of their easy access via two doors, many people purchase tunnel containers as storage units. Tunnel containers are a cost-effective way to create safe storage space and can be easily converted by the help of a wall to create two storage units. Many self-storage yards use tunnel containers because they can be a great method to quickly rotate inventory or control stock levels.
In some cases, tunnel containers can be fitted with a turntable that makes it easier to move things around them. This is particularly beneficial if you're using them as an office or workshop and require the movement of heavy equipment frequently in and out.
Tunnel containers are also available in a high cube model, which offers an additional foot of height. This can make a huge difference when it comes to storing tall or bulky items, and make them an excellent option for warehouses or other fast-paced environments.
Addition of side windows and lighting is another frequent modification. This is similar to what you would do with a standard shipping box. It is easier to work at night in a tunnel for containers with side windows. These modifications are very simple to make, and can be completed by a competent DIYer.
Security
Shipping containers are frequently used for storage and therefore security is a must. Most containers use padlocks as a means of protecting the doors. However, they can be damaged by bolt cutters, lock pickers or drilling. It's always recommended to add an extra layer of security. This can be done by putting in a lock box, like our Contain-A-Lock, a patent-pending product. These are used to cover the locks on the doors of your shipping container and are tamper proof and corrosion resistant. They can also be color-matched to your container to provide extra security.
You can also attach a crossbar to the handle of the container to provide additional security. These are extendable locking clamps that make it difficult for criminals to separate the handle from the locking rod and can help to deter thieves by making it much difficult to open the doors of your container.
Another way to improve your container's security is adding a CCTV system. This will be a deterrent to thieves, and could assist in catching them in the case of a burglary. You can also put in an alarm that will sound if someone tries to gain access to the container. This is a great deterrent to criminals, since they'll be less likely to think about attempting a break-in if they know that they will be heard and captured on camera.
You can also add a variety of security features to your shipping container to increase its security. This includes fencing around the container, lighting on the exterior, and adding climate control systems if you're using your shipping container for temperature sensitive goods such as electronics or artwork.
Finally, you should consider adding seals to your shipping container to keep pests and water out. They are simple to put in and can increase the resistance of your container from being damaged by. These are especially useful for shipping items by sea, as they signal to authorities that the container has been opened. Access
As the name suggests, tunnel containers come with standard double doors at both ends. This is a major difference over conventional shipping containers, which only have doors on one end. This makes them ideal for storage since items can be easily loaded into and out of the container from both sides. Hand dolly ramps and forklift ramps can be put on tunnel containers to facilitate easy access when moving bulky or heavy objects.
Tunnel containers with dual entry points are also great for boiler rooms and machinery storage, since they eliminate the need to reverse vehicles. tunnel shipping containers containers can also be converted into mobile offices or living spaces by adding side windows as well as internal partition walls.
TITAN offers double-door tunnel containers in 20ft and 40ft. These new containers comply with ISO shipping standards and are suitable for international freight usage. They can also be fitted with shelving and pipe racks to make the most of space. Additionally, they come with built-in vents to ensure sufficient airflow and stop moisture build-up.
Due to their design, these containers can also be modified to allow access control to the site through the installation of a turnstile, or a manual secure entry checkpoint. This is usually used to direct people through security or ticket checks at large events.
Tunnel containers are a very popular storage option as well. They can be divided into two separate containers of 10ft each, each with its own double doors. This can be particularly useful for self storage companies where they wish to simplify the process for customers to access their own containers e.g. labeling storage compartments a good way to do this. It is also possible to weld in steel bulkheads to divide the container into smaller parts in the event of need, such as splitting a 20ft tunnel container in half, leaving two separate storage units of 10 feet with doors. This makes them a cost-effective option for customers looking to store their equipment or parts on their own premises.
